Procedures for press recordings at the airport
Fraport Brasil informs that all recordings, image capturing, interviews or any other press activities at Fortaleza Airport must be requested in accordance with the procedures below:
To photograph or film press vehicles on the terminal premises, authorization must be requested at least 24 hours in advance, for areas without restricted access (such as the lobby), by emailing imprensafor@fraport-brasil.com, containing the day, time and duration, areas to be accessed and the reason and/or agenda.
To ensure operational safety, Fraport Brasil does not allow access to restricted areas, such as the courtyard, departure/departure lounges and construction areas, for the purpose of taking photos or making recordings. This is Fraport Brasil's commercial positioning and is applied to everyone, in order to maintain equal treatment of such requests.
For requests related to advertising campaigns, please check prices with the sales department.
Fraport will analyze requests on a case-by-case basis and reserves the right to deny authorization if it does not agree with the action. These measures are intended to ensure the safety of airport operations, the organization of the environment and the comfort of users. Our priority is the well-being of passengers and airport users and ensuring safety, which is a non-negotiable asset.

Procedures for spotters
Since October 1, 2021, plane spotting sessions at Fortaleza Airport require registration with Fraport Brasil, at least three working days in advance.
Registration can be renewed every year and allows you to carry out photographic activities in the airport's external area, near the railings (Formigueiro and Proair), without requesting authorization for each session.
To register, send the following details and documents to imprensafor@fraport-brasil.com:
- Contact telephone number and e-mail address
- Copy of ID and CPF or CNH (driver's license)
- Certificate of Distribution of State Justice (first degree only). For residents of the state of Ceará, this is available at the following link: https: //sirece.tjce.jus.br/sirece-web/nova/solicitacao.jsf. Residents of other states should consult their local Judiciary.
once you have confirmed that you have registered, you will only need to identify yourself to the security guard on duty at each activity.
Important: in addition to registering, each spotter must provide their own standard reflective vest, in blue and with the name SPOTTER, as shown in the example below. During photographic activities, it will be compulsory to be on the list of registered spotters and to wear the vest.
When collecting personal data, Fraport Brasil uses it to control access to the airport site, with the aim of guaranteeing airport operational security. Personal data is kept in a controlled location and remains stored for the duration of the Fortaleza Airport concession or until its owner requests its disposal.
